BBC Publishes Distorted Map of India

Ashwin Shukla 1, kaliyug Varsha 5113


A distorted map of India published by BBC has created a new controversy. The British Broadcasting Corporation, in a news piece on Agni V launch, had carried a map of India. BBC has claimed the source as Defence Research Developmental Organization (DRDO), Government of India. The map has the parts of Jammu and Kashmir eaten away, which irked eyes of some Indian readers.
There were some tweets seen in twitter objecting the map and requesting BBC to withdraw it immediately.
